Crawl space trenching is a service that involves digging around the perimeter of a property’s foundation to create a narrow, excavated trench. This process helps improve drainage and manage moisture levels beneath the home. The trenches allow for the installation of drainage systems, such as weeping tiles or French drains, which direct excess water away from the foundation. Proper trenching can help prevent water from pooling around the foundation, reducing the risk of basement flooding, mold growth, and structural damage caused by prolonged exposure to moisture.
This service is particularly beneficial for addressing common issues like persistent dampness, musty odors, and uneven settling of the foundation. When moisture seeps into the crawl space, it can lead to wood rot, mold growth, and pest infestations. Trenching helps mitigate these problems by improving water runoff and ventilation, creating a drier and healthier environment beneath the home. It is often recommended after foundation repairs or when signs of water damage and high humidity are evident in the crawl space area.
Properties that typically benefit from crawl space trenching include older homes with shallow or poorly designed drainage systems, homes situated on sloped or uneven terrain, and properties experiencing ongoing water intrusion problems. Newer homes may also require trenching if drainage issues are identified early or if landscaping modifications have altered natural water flow. Commercial buildings with crawl spaces or basements prone to moisture buildup can also be candidates for this service. Overall, any property facing persistent moisture or drainage concerns can benefit from professional trenching to protect its foundation and interior spaces.

What is crawl space trenching? Crawl space trenching involves excavating around a building’s foundation to improve drainage and prevent moisture issues in the crawl space area.
Why might someone need crawl space trenching services? This service is often needed to address persistent dampness, water intrusion, or foundation problems that can affect the stability and dryness of a crawl space.
What should I consider before hiring a contractor for crawl space trenching? It’s important to evaluate the contractor’s experience with foundation work, ensure they understand local soil conditions, and verify their ability to handle the specific needs of your property.
How do local contractors typically perform crawl space trenching? They typically excavate around the foundation, install drainage systems, and backfill with proper materials to ensure effective water management and foundation support.
Are there different types of trenching options for crawl spaces? Yes, options can include perimeter trenching, interior trenching, or a combination, depending on the drainage needs and the layout of the property.
